"Ceph数据迁移之美:深度理解Peering过程"
需积分: 10 55 浏览量
更新于2024-02-02
收藏 473KB PPTX 举报
本文主要关注关于ceph迁移中的Peering技术,通过分析"PPT深刻理解Peering,看完就懂Peering每个过程在干什么"和"LOGO Ceph 数据迁移之美之 Peering"两个文档的内容,总结出以下要点。
Peering作为一个关键的数据迁移过程,在ceph中起着重要的作用。Peering的概念、原理和流程是我们首先需要了解的。Peering是指将存储Placement Group (PG)的所有OSD达成一致,以确定PG的状态。Peering包括了一系列的过程,如Interval、pg info、pg log等,并且还涉及到了一些相关的概念。
Peering中的几个状态,如GetInfo、GetLog、GetMissing和Activate,是Peering状态机的关键状态,它们在Peering过程中扮演着重要的角色。当OSD的增加或删除导致PG的acting set发生变化时,PG将重新发起Peering过程。同时,在系统初始化阶段,OSD重新启动会导致PG重新加载,PG新创建时也会发起一次Peering过程。
Peering是PG内OSD达成一致的过程。根据ceph官方的定义,Peering是将所有存储PG的OSD达成一致,确定PG的状态。在Peering过程中,各个OSD会相互通信,交换自身的状态和信息,以实现一致性。
除了上述几点,创新和技术方面的东西我们也能从文中得到,但它们的描述比较简要,不够详细。从整体来看,本文以一种系统化和连贯的方式介绍了Peering在ceph迁移中的重要性和实际应用。通过对Peering的深入理解,可以更好地了解PG的状态和OSD之间的通信方式,为ceph迁移过程提供指导和支持。
总结起来,本文通过分析"PPT深刻理解Peering,看完就懂Peering每个过程在干什么"和"LOGOCeph 数据迁移之美之 Peering"这两个文档,介绍了ceph迁移中Peering技术的概念、原理、流程和关键状态。同时,还强调了Peering在ceph迁移中的重要性,并提供了一些实际应用的示例。这些内容对于理解和应用Peering技术具有重要意义。
2019-03-05 上传
梦想SEer
- 粉丝: 2
- 资源: 2
最新资源
- SSM Java项目:StudentInfo 数据管理与可视化分析
- pyedgar:Python库简化EDGAR数据交互与文档下载
- Node.js环境下wfdb文件解码与实时数据处理
- phpcms v2.2企业级网站管理系统发布
- 美团饿了么优惠券推广工具-uniapp源码
- 基于红外传感器的会议室实时占用率测量系统
- DenseNet-201预训练模型:图像分类的深度学习工具箱
- Java实现和弦移调工具:Transposer-java
- phpMyFAQ 2.5.1 Beta多国语言版:技术项目源码共享平台
- Python自动化源码实现便捷自动下单功能
- Android天气预报应用:查看多城市详细天气信息
- PHPTML类:简化HTML页面创建的PHP开源工具
- Biovec在蛋白质分析中的应用:预测、结构和可视化
- EfficientNet-b0深度学习工具箱模型在MATLAB中的应用
- 2024年河北省技能大赛数字化设计开发样题解析
- 笔记本USB加湿器:便携式设计解决方案